Signed limited edition of Field's classic collection of children's poetry; one of five hundred copies printed on Imperial Japan vellum by the Lake Side Press and signed by the author's wife, Julia Sutherland Field, and the couple's five children. Octavo, bound in full crushed levant morocco, gilt titles and tooling to the spine in six compartments within raised gilt bands, gilt fleuron cornerpieces to the front and rear panels embellished with morocco onlays, wide gilt inner dentelles, silk watered endleaves, top edge gilt, text in facsimile script. In near fine condition.
Often referred to as “the poet of childhood” American author Eugene Field began publishing poetry in 1879, when his poem “Christmas Treasures” appeared in A Little Book of Western Verse. Over a dozen volumes of poetry followed and he became well known for his light-hearted poems for children, among the most famous of which are “Wynken, Blynken, and Nod” and “The Duel.” Equally famous is his poem about the death of a child, “Little Boy Blue.”
